Understanding Quantum Computing Basics:
At its core, this technology leverages the phenomena of quantum mechanics, notably superposition and entanglement, to perform calculations more efficiently. Unlike classical computers that use bits, quantum computers use qubits, which can be in multiple states simultaneously. Applications and Impacts:
Quantum computing holds potential in fields such as cryptography, where it could break the most sophisticated encryption algorithms, changing the landscape of data security. In pharmaceuticals, it might enable faster drug discovery by modeling molecular interactions with unparalleled precision.
